The M11x is everything a radio needs to be but Airtronics got STUPID and the Rx is not HV ready. No lipo unregulated.
If they fix thier Rx, and come down $150 bucks less.........
The DX3r works very well, can handle high temps (unlike Futaba), and has a RX thats Lipo ready. Costs alot less than the M11x or 4pk.
Its steering wheel is fugly, deosn't have a vibrating pit timer, and it uses queer looking silver plastic. I haven't found a trigger tension adjustment. The brakes are kinda stiff. Can't adjust brakes on the fly (stiff switches). Cheap Horizon hobby feel and look.
I'm still running a tattered M8 with Novak synth module (that if it gets any warmer its going to melt) and Hitec synth Rx. Can run lipo unregulated with old rusty, I don't know how F and At can charge 400+ for something that can't handle real batteries.

I use a m11 but i got to molest a M11x and it's nice. Lighter but still balanced. comes with a rechargeable pack, not a lipo but doesn't really matter unless you get hung up on stuff like that. It has a cool feature when you switch your cars it will failsafe till the model is selected. If i was getting a new radio that would be it ! The dx3r is alright i have used it but it just has a cheap feel and the brake isn't as nice. A M11 gives that hand to car connection like no other.
